Modern Times Group agreed to sell 95% of its shares in Bulgarian unit NOVA Broadcasting Group AD to investment firm PPF Group for €185 million.
The transaction values 100% of the business, according to a Feb. 19 news release.
MTG will use the proceeds from the deal to invest in its Nordic Entertainment and Studios units, as well as its global digital entertainment businesses. The company also intends to focus on these verticals moving forward.
The announcement to sell its Bulgarian unit comes after TDC A/S pulled out from a $2.5 billion deal to acquire MTG's broadcasting and entertainment assets. The Danish operator backed out from the deal after accepting a revised takeover offer of 50.25 Danish kroner per TDC share from a consortium led by Macquarie Infrastructure.
Citigroup Global Market acts as MTG's financial adviser in the current transaction.
